Advanced Project Management
To enable ākonga to apply advanced project management principles, methods, and leadership strategies to deliver value and achieve objectives in complex projects across diverse and dynamic professional environments, upholding te Tiriti o Waitangi and kaupapa Māori values in stakeholder relationships and leadership practice.
| Information | |
|---|---|
| Course Code | AMPM701 |
| Level | 7 |
| Credits | 15 |
Description
The learning outcomes for this course are:
Apply advanced project management principles and methods to plan, deliver, and adapt complex projects in dynamic environments
Lead project teams by applying emotional intelligence, cultural intelligence, stakeholder management, and strategic communication, upholding te Tiriti o Waitangi and kaupapa Māori values in building respectful relationships, to achieve project objectives
Manage ethical, operational, and contextual challenges with resilience, professionalism, and culturally responsive practices in complex project settings
Critically reflect on contemporary project management issues and professional practices to inform strategic decision-making and continuous improvement
